Crawley Town and Stevenage have played out a 1-1 draw at the Broadfield Stadium in League One.

The first goal of the game came in the 21st minute when Bira Dembele headed home from close range.

The visitors dominated the rest of the first half and had chances through Michael Doughty and Francois Zoko, but failed to add to their tally.

Crawley stepped up their game in the second half, with Jamie Proctor, Matthew Tubbs and Billy Clarke all going close in the early stages but in vain.

The hosts had a great chance to equalise in the 73rd minute. Jon Ashton brought down Proctor inside the Stevenage penalty area and the referee pointed to the spot.

Tubbs, though, saw his effort from 12 yards saved by goalkeeper Chris Day.

However, the 29-year-old striker redeemed himself in the second minute of injury time when he latched on to Dannie Bulman's pass and shot home from close range to salvage a point for John Gregory's side.
